Conversion work is easy I have done a few. On the 308 you need a converted trigger group (only if you intend on keeping your bho lever) http://Dinzagarms.com/misc_parts/fcg.html

 

Everything else is self explanitory. The only thimg you can keep from your stock fcg would be the hammer... unless u can weld a trigger to the existing internal trigger. But you need to be 922r compliant. So i suggest swapping it all out... a fcg counts as 3 parts.

 

Check out carolina shooter supply for parts also he ships super fast and most stuff gets to u in 2 days.
